The annual Saleen Show is back, and for 2008 it will be held in conjunction with the Beach Cities Mustang Club's Mustangs at the Queen Mary show on Sunday, October 5.

This is an official Saleen Inc. event, and they will be bringing the Saleen big rig to house several special displays. Participants and spectators alike will get to see Saleen's first public unveiling of a new Mustang model; Speedlab will be there featuring their latest aftermarket parts for Mustangs, Expeditions and Navigators; and you'll also get to see the new Racecraft 420S Mustang.

We're still working on details, but we wanted to get the word out so you can register.

The pre-registration deadline is September 15, and pricing varies from $35 for online or $40 for mail-in -- but please register today to ensure your place at this landmark event!
